Cultural data portal
In collaboration with the Department of Informatics at King's, Culture is developing a cultural data portal to provide the sector with access to high-quality data to support decision-making, planning, advocacy and artistic practice; and to provide Informatics students with a live portal for learning and research.
We feel that in the age of open data, linked data and APIs, the time is right to bring together relevant data sets and develop an interface that really allows people to explore this information at their fingertips. We view this data portal as a ‘sister site’ to CultureCase, ensuring that it is imbued with the same qualities of simplistic design and intuitive search.
The project has already explored potential data sets that can go into the portal. The architecture of the database and eventual interface is still being developed. We are also holding conversations with data holders in the UK arts and culture sector and seeking to gather the input of relevant experts and potential users. We expect to launch a prototype version of the portal in early 2017.
